League Two: Cheltenham Town v Dagenham & Redbridge, Saturday, August 18, kick-off 3pm

To send a link to this page to a friend, you must be logged in.

Striker Dwight Gayle is expected to make his highly-anticipated Dagenham & Redbridge debut at Cheltenham Town tomorrow after overcoming a thigh strain.

Gayle was withdrawn after 45 minutes of Saturday’s 6-3 pre-season win over West Ham and watched from the stands as Daggers suffered a 1-0 defeat to Coventry City on Tuesday night.

However, the 21-year-old is expected to be included in the 18-man matchday squad for the trip to Whaddon Road.

Dominic Green should be fit enough to be included on the bench, but fellow midfielders Kevin Maher (foot) and Matthew Saunders (ankle) are definitely out.

Cheltenham Town have no injury problems with Steve Elliott and Jeff Goulding having recovered from their respective knocks.
